Output 66400e1091cdbcc955785bfa6cc4de6a787cc9dd244c7cbf28240ad39d109a38:1

value
707668
script pubkey
OP_0 OP_PUSHBYTES_20 129666ca7a7c3b18a7fc0988d385d8aede0799e7
address
ltc1qz2txdjn60sa33flupxyd8pwc4m0q0x088egadu
transaction
66400e1091cdbcc955785bfa6cc4de6a787cc9dd244c7cbf28240ad39d109a38
spent
true